  • The White House
    The White House is both the home of the president of the United States and his family and a living gallery of American history.
  • Supreme Court
    The Supreme Court of the United States is the highest court in the federal judiciary of the United States of America. Also referred to as "THE MARBLE PALACE"
  • U.S. Marine Corps War Memorial
    It addresses the country's appreciation to marines and the individuals who battled next to them.
  • Jefferson Memorial
    It was built to commemorate Thomas Jefferson who was an architect and the principal author of the Declaration of the United States
  • Lincoln Memorial
    Honors the 16th and perhaps the greatest president of the United States, and represents his confidence in the nobility and the opportunity, everything being equal.
  • Vietnam Veterans Memorial
    It represents the American men and women who served and sacrificed their lives in the Vietnam War.
  • You will be pass by Tidal Basin, Watergate complex, Washington Monument and Smithsonian Institution Building. (pass by)
  • Korean War Veterans Memorial
    The memorial commemorates the sacrifices of 5.8 million Americans who served during the three years of the Korean war.
  • Pass by Rock Creek Park, Georgetown, Dupont Circle. (pass by)
  • U.S. Capitol
    It is the most symbolically important and architecturally impressive buildings in the nation.
  • Embassy Row is the informal name for the section of Massachusetts Avenue, N.W. between Scott Circle and the North side of the United States Naval Observatory in Washington, D.C., in which embassies, diplomatic missions, and other diplomatic representations in the United States are concentrated. (pass by)
  • Washington National Cathedral
    The second-largest church building in the United States and the fourth tallest in the Washington DC
  • Franklin D. Roosevelt's memorial was made in memory of one of the best American leaders. (pass by)
  • National World War II Memorial was built in the honor of 16 million who died fighting World War II. (pass by)
  • Smithsonian American Art Museum is known for the most inclusive American Art collection in the world. (pass by)
  • Martin Luther King, Jr.'s Memorial represents the legacy and the struggle for freedom, equality, and justice (pass by)
  • Ulysses S. Grant memorial honors the Civil War Commander of the Union Armies who was also a two-term President (pass by)
